What does DVD mean as an abbreviation? 224 popular meanings of DVD abbreviation: 50 Categories. Sort. DVD … WebDVD stands for Digital Versatile Disc. It is commonly known as Digital Video Disc. It is a digital optical disc storage format used to store high-capacity data like high-quality videos and movies. It is also used to store the operating system. It was invented and developed by four companies named Philips, Sony, Toshiba, and Panasonic in 1995. WebA CD contains the spacing of 1.6 micrometers between spiral tracks and 0.834 micrometers between the pits on the disk. The spiral loops in DVD are 0.74 micrometers apart and the distance between the pits is 0.4 micrometers. The laser wavelength for reading and burning a CD is 780 nanometer.

WebOct 20, 2024 · DVD-R is one of two standards for recordable DVDs, along with DVD+R. It is a write-once format, meaning that data is written to the disc permanently and cannot be erased or modified. Of the two standards, DVD-R is compatible with more players than …
